The Core Role: Upholding Due Process

A process server is a trained and licensed professional responsible for delivering legal documents to individuals involved in a court case. This act is known as **“service of process.”** Its primary purpose is to satisfy a cornerstone of the American legal system: **due process**. Due process ensures that all parties in a legal action are properly notified, giving them a fair opportunity to respond and present their case.

Without proper service of process, a court case cannot legally proceed, and any judgments made could be invalidated.

What is a process server and what do they do?

A process server is a trained and licensed professional responsible for delivering legal documents to individuals involved in a court case. This act is known as 'service of process' and is essential for upholding due process rights in the legal system.

Is a process server required for all legal documents in Oklahoma?

For most court-filed documents that initiate a lawsuit or require a response, a licensed third-party process server is required to ensure service is legally valid and impartial.

Do process servers provide proof of service?

Yes, process servers complete a sworn Affidavit of Service after delivery, providing legal proof with detailed time, date, location, and manner of service information required by Oklahoma courts.

What types of legal documents do process servers deliver?

Process servers deliver summons and complaints, divorce papers, subpoenas, eviction notices, restraining orders, small claims documents, citations, and business litigation papers.
